Jul 14, 2015Who Me? is another quirky entry in Wauters’s unique discography. But it’s also his most honest, delicate effort to date--two good qualities for a musician with so much natural charisma to explore.
-
May 18, 2015Who Me?, then, is a weird, loveable record to file alongside Wauters’ labelmate and touring buddy Mac DeMarco.
-
May 18, 2015Wauters has always seemed breezy but never quite so meek.
-
May 18, 2015Like its predecessor, Who Me? is a showcase for Wauters' quirky, likeable personality, and balances introspective lyrics with laid-back instrumentation.
-
May 21, 2015There are clear-eyed moments of introspection and observation, as on I Was Well and This Is I, but overall the album suffers from a lack of ingenuity.
-
May 18, 2015It’s the bookends of Who Me? that shine some light on Wauters’ troubadour potential.
